High-Power Mode-Locked Fiber Laser Using Lead Sulfide Quantum Dots Saturable Absorber

Not Accessible

Your library or personal account may give you access

Abstract

The discovery of different types of nanomaterials including the one-dimensional and two-dimensional materials used as saturable absorbers (SAs) in the applications of ultrafast lasers in recent years increases the ultrafast laser design flexibility and boosts the laser performances. A major research avenue is to explore the potential of nanomaterials for further enhancing the performances of ultrafast lasers in terms of pulse power. To this aim, in this study, using a hot-injection method and drop-coating technology, a fiber-based lead sulfide quantum dot (PbS QD) is synthesized, and its potential as a SA for the generation of higher-power pulses is demonstrated in an erbium-doped fiber laser (EDFL). Experimental results show that the optical damage threshold of the SA is greater than 152.6 mJ/cm2, and the modulation depth is up to 29.5%. The implementation of the PbS QD as a SA placed in an EDFL enables the laser to yield 2.84 ps ultrashort pulses with an average output power of 59.4 mW at a repetition rate of 6.97 MHz. To the best of our knowledge, it is the highest average output power obtained in ultrafast fiber lasers mode-locked by zero-dimensional QD materials. The results suggest the great potential of PbS QDs in the application that requires the generation of high-power pulses in ultrafast lasers.
